v2.1.0

This new minor release brings back the commented struct field tag from go-toml v1. It makes it easier to generate default or example configuration files. For instance:

type TLS struct {
	Cipher  string `toml:"cipher"`
	Version string `toml:"version"`
}
type Config struct {
	Host string `toml:"host" comment:"Host IP to connect to."`
	Port int    `toml:"port" comment:"Port of the remote server."`
	Tls  TLS    `toml:"TLS,commented" comment:"Encryption parameters (optional)"`
}
example := Config{
	Host: "127.0.0.1",
	Port: 4242,
	Tls: TLS{
		Cipher:  "AEAD-AES128-GCM-SHA256",
		Version: "TLS 1.3",
	},
}
out, err := toml.Marshal(example)

generates this TOML document:

# Host IP to connect to.
host = '127.0.0.1'
# Port of the remote server.
port = 4242
Encryption parameters (optional)
[TLS]
cipher = 'AEAD-AES128-GCM-SHA256'
version = 'TLS 1.3'

This feature was often mentioned as a blocker to upgrading from go-toml v1. Hopefully bringing it back in scope will help folks make the transition!
